Where Should I go: Amman or Chennai?

Amman

Amman is the largest city in of the Hashemite Kingdom of the country of Jordan. It is also the capital city of Jordan and has a population of over four million people. Many people use Amman as a base for venturing out into the rest of Jordan and other surrounding countries. There are many things to see and do in Amman.

Chennai

Formerly known as Madras from its colonial history, Chennai today is one of India's largest cities and capital of the Indian state of Tamil Nadu. It is located on the Bay of Bengal in southeastern India with an extensive stretch of sandy beaches, plenty of dining and shopping, a number of historic temples, monuments, and churches, plus amusement parks and more.

Which place is cheaper, Chennai or Amman?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ations. These travel costs come from the actual spending of real travelers.

The average daily cost (per person) in Amman is $135, while the average daily cost in Chennai is $30.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Amman and Chennai in more detail.



Accommodation
  • Accommodation Hotel or hostel for one person
    Amman $49
    Chennai $14
  • Accommodation Typical double-occupancy room
    Amman $98
    Chennai $28

When we compare the travel costs of actual travelers between Amman and Chennai, we can see that Amman is more expensive. And not only is Chennai much less expensive, but it is actually a significantly cheaper destination. Since Amman is in Middle East and Chennai is in Asia, this is one of the main reasons why the costs are so different, as different regions of the world tend to have overall different travel costs. So, traveling to Chennai would let you spend less money overall. Or, you could decide to spend more money in Chennai and be able to afford a more luxurious travel style by staying in nicer hotels, eating at more expensive restaurants, taking tours, and experiencing more activities. The same level of travel in Amman would naturally cost you much more money, so you would probably want to keep your budget a little tighter in Amman than you might in Chennai.
